In 2023, Proctor, MN had a population of 3.1k people with a median age of 41.2 and a median household income of $80,913. Between 2022 and 2023 the population of Proctor, MN declined from 3,113 to 3,102, a −0.353% decrease and its median household income grew from $80,385 to $80,913, a 0.657% increase.
The 5 largest ethnic groups in Proctor, MN are White (Non-Hispanic) (91%), American Indian & Alaska Native (Non-Hispanic) (3.68%), Asian (Non-Hispanic) (3.09%), Two+ (Non-Hispanic) (1.93%), and Two+ (Hispanic) (0.258%).
None of the households in Proctor, MN reported speaking a non-English language at home as their primary shared language. This does not consider the potential multi-lingual nature of households, but only the primary self-reported language spoken by all members of the household.
99.6% of the residents in Proctor, MN are U.S. citizens.
In 2023, the median property value in Proctor, MN was $219,500, and the homeownership rate was 72.3%.
Most people in Proctor, MN drove alone to work, and the average commute time was 15.7 minutes. The average car ownership in Proctor, MN was 2 cars per household.
